Ex- Service Chief In Trouble, May Be Prosecuted

<h4>Ex -Service Chief In Trouble&comma; May Be Prosecuted<&sol;h4>&NewLine;<p>OpenLife Nigeria reports that a Human Rights Advocacy Centre has called on the Department of States Services to investigate the governorship candidate of the All Progressives Congress in Bauchi State&comma; Air Marshal Sadique Abubakar &lpar;rtd&rpar; over alleged link to insecurity in the state&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>The rights group in a letter signed by its convener&comma; Comrade Ajibade Moses Adebayo and addressed to the Director-General of the secret police&comma; called for Sadique’s investigation&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>The centre said its position was hinged on the APC guber candidate’s &O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;blatant and arrogant display of power and affluence with known supporters of his oppressing and coercing citizens into submission to his whims and caprices”&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>It alleged that the former Chief of Air Staff has equipped a militia group to oppress dissenting voices opposed to him&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>The centre&comma; therefore&comma; charged the DSS to investigate the former CAS to ascertain his complicity and culpability in the recent surge in insecurity in Bauchi&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>&O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;We fear that if the situation is allowed to fester&comma; Bauchi might erupt in violence and become the new operational headquarters for terrorist groups&comma;” the centre added&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>&OpenCurlyDoubleQuote;It is our prayer that in the event that Abubakar is found guilty&comma; he should be made to face the full wrath of the law&period; Bauchi is bleeding at the moment”&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>The ex-service chief defeated four other aspirants with 370 votes on Thursday&comma; May 27&comma; 2022 and was elected the governorship candidate of the All Progressives Congress in Bauchi State&period;<br &sol;>&NewLine;Abubakar served as Nigeria’s Chief of Air Staff from July 13&comma; 2015&comma; to January 26&comma; 2021&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>His closest rival&comma; Halliru Jika&comma; a Senator representing Bauchi Central&comma; scored 278 votes&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>Nura Manu polled 269 votes&comma; Musa Babayo scored 70 votes&comma; while Mahmud Maijama’a scored 8 votes&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p>Muhammed Pate did not score any vote&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;
